Core Stability Exercises With Surface Electromyography Biofeedback in Patients With Mechanical Low Back Pain

NCT05425121 · Status: UNKNOWN · Phase: NA ·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 52

Last updated 2022-06-21

No results posted yet for this study

Summary

This study will be conducted on patients of mechanical low back pain. Surface electromyography biofeedback driven core stability protocol will be given to experimental group and the control group will be treated with core stabilization regimen. Then it will compare the effects of surface electromyography biofeedback with core stability on postural stability and sensory integration of balance .

Interventions

PROCEDURE

Core stability exercises

The intervention in the control group will core stability exercises for different back muscles and strengthening exercises of Gluteal Muscles.

DEVICE

Biofeedback training

EMG biofeedback training will be administered to the participants in combination with core stability exercise training.
